The Database Administrator III applies current technology in providing database design and administration for one or more medium to large-sized databases. Under general guidance, provide business application solutions. Must have a thorough understanding of hardware/software and communication environments such as: client/server technology, host/mainframe technology, IS, and related peripheral equipment. Specifies proper types of file organization, indexing methods, and security procedures. Advises project teams on the design of moderately complex databases (e.g., schema and subschema details). Defines specialized aspects of user's database administrator documentation. Performs detailed comparisons of various database systems. Develops backup and archival policies and procedures. Configures storage systems software to meet requirements. Performs administration tasks (installing, maintaining, monitoring, recovering, rebuilding, upgrading, patching, and performance tuning). Implements software solutions for performance enhancement, operator interface, and increased user capability. A significant degree of creativity and latitude is required.
